Nicola Ferrier is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Biomedical Engineering and Media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Nicola Ferrier has authored 110 papers receiving a total of 3.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 29 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 19 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 18 papers in Media Technology. Recurrent topics in Nicola Ferrier's work include Advanced Vision and Imaging (14 papers), Image Processing Techniques and Applications (13 papers) and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(10 papers). Nicola Ferrier is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Vision and Imaging (14 papers), Image Processing Techniques and Applications (13 papers) and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(10 papers). Nicola Ferrier coll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Belgium. Nicola Ferrier's co-authors include Paul F. Nealey, Juan Pablo, Sang Ouk Kim, Harun H. Solak, Mark P. Stoykovich, Michael Zinn, Frank E. Pfefferkorn, Paul A. Larsen, James B. Rawlings and Axel Fehrenbacher and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and ACS Nano.
